As our Process Automation Specialist, you'll be key to our ongoing expansion. You'll automate internal processes using no-code platforms like Webflow, Integromat/Zapier and manage data with Google Sheets. On a typical day, you might identify a process to optimize, design an automated workflow, troubleshoot existing systems, or transform complex data into actionable insights. Through collaboration with our global team, your role will be instrumental in enhancing our operations, supporting our growth, and enriching our unique travel experiences.

**Requirements**:

-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ills
- Proficiency in using no code platforms, especially Webflow, Integromat (Make)
- Strong understanding of Google Sheets formulas
- A proven track record of working independently and finding creative solutions to problems
- A proactive attitude, thriving in challenging situations, and a commitment to delivering high-quality work
- A deep commitment to continuous learning and professional growth
- Proficiency in English; fluency in additional languages is a plus
